gunô (Badlit spelling ᜄᜓᜈᜓ)

  1. a tropical silverside (Atherinomorus duodecimalis)
  2. a hardyhead silverside (Atherinomorus lacunosus)
  3. a sardinella; any fish of the genus Sardinella
